A 25-guest wedding in Colorado Springs typically runs $12,000 – $24,000 all-in, with most couples landing near $16,500. That's materially lower than a full-size wedding, but venue minimums, Pikes Peak views, and altitude-related vendor travel can push the per-guest cost higher than you'd expect.

Typical allocation for a 25-guest wedding in Colorado Springs, CO:

Category Lean ($12K) Typical ($16.5K) Elevated ($24K)
Venue + rentals $2,000 $3,500 $6,500
Catering + bar (25 guests) $2,500 $3,800 $6,000
Photography $2,200 $3,200 $4,500
Flowers + decor $900 $1,500 $2,800
Attire (both partners) $1,500 $2,200 $3,500
Music / DJ $600 $1,000 $1,800
Cake / dessert $300 $500 $900
Officiant $350 $500 $750
Stationery + signage $250 $400 $700
Hair + makeup $400 $700 $1,200
Coordinator (day-of) $800 $1,200 $2,000
Marriage license + fees $30 $30 $30
Buffer (10%) $170 $970 $2,320

Per-guest spend: roughly $480 (lean) to $960 (elevated), with catering-only per-guest running $100 – $240 depending on plated vs. buffet and bar tier.

For 25 guests, the single biggest lever is whether you book a venue with a food-and-beverage minimum or one that lets you bring in outside catering. The second saves $2,000 – $4,000 on average at this headcount.

Is $15,000 enough for a 25-guest wedding in Colorado Springs?

Yes, comfortably, if you're flexible on date and venue. $15,000 covers a full-service micro-wedding with professional photography, a seated dinner, florals, and a coordinator — typically at an off-peak date (April, May, October, or a Friday/Sunday in peak season).

What's the cheapest realistic venue for 25 guests in Colorado Springs?

Public-land permits at places like Garden of the Gods (ceremony permit ~$105) or Seven Falls paired with a private restaurant dinner can bring venue costs under $1,500 total. Boutique mountain inns and restaurant buyouts typically start around $2,500 – $3,500.

How much should I budget for catering per person?

Plan $100 – $180 per guest for food and non-alcoholic beverages at a seated dinner, and add $35 – $75 per guest for a full bar. Buffets and family-style run 15–25% less than plated service.

Do I need a wedding planner for a 25-person wedding?

You don't need a full planner, but a day-of coordinator ($800 – $1,500) is worth it. Even small weddings have 30+ moving pieces on the day, and coordinators usually save you their fee in vendor negotiations and timeline efficiency.

What are the hidden costs people forget?

The most commonly missed line items are vendor tips (15–20% of service totals, roughly $500 – $1,200), tax and service charges on catering (often 25–30% on top of the food cost), marriage license and officiant fees, and weather contingency for outdoor Colorado ceremonies.

How far in advance should I book vendors for a Colorado Springs micro-wedding?

Book venue and photographer 8–12 months out for peak season (June–September) and 4–6 months out for off-season. Small-guest-count weddings are often easier to book late, but the best mountain-view venues sell out first.

Can we legally marry ourselves in Colorado to save money?

Yes. Colorado is one of the few states that allows self-solemnization — you sign your own marriage license with no officiant required. That saves $400 – $750 and lets you design the ceremony however you want.
